From d9f83f1fd2a1cfdeb73b406c8776ebdfe3fbdb89 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Vladim=C3=ADr=20Vondru=C5=A1?= Date: Tue, 16 Aug 2016 16:32:18 +0200 Subject: [PATCH] Audio: test Buffer construction. --- src/Magnum/Audio/Test/BufferTest.cpp | 12 +++++++++++- 1 file changed, 11 insertions(+), 1 deletion(-) diff --git a/src/Magnum/Audio/Test/BufferTest.cpp b/src/Magnum/Audio/Test/BufferTest.cpp index c98c6e746..8de56d8b9 100644 --- a/src/Magnum/Audio/Test/BufferTest.cpp +++ b/src/Magnum/Audio/Test/BufferTest.cpp @@ -27,17 +27,27 @@ #include #include "Magnum/Audio/Buffer.h" +#include "Magnum/Audio/Context.h" namespace Magnum { namespace Audio { namespace Test { struct BufferTest: TestSuite::Tester { explicit BufferTest(); + void construct(); void debugFormat(); + + Context _context; }; BufferTest::BufferTest() { - addTests({&BufferTest::debugFormat}); + addTests({&BufferTest::construct, + &BufferTest::debugFormat}); +} + +void BufferTest::construct() { + Buffer buf; + CORRADE_VERIFY(buf.id() != 0); } void BufferTest::debugFormat() {